"I'm thoroughly culturally invested in helping the people of India now that I have a familial tie that is very deep and very meaningful," the governor said.
This isn't the first such trip Huntsman has headed since taking office in 2005. He has led similar trade missions to Mexico, China and Canada that focused on meeting key leaders, including former Mexican President Vicente Fox, who later came to Utah and addressed the Legislature. Huntsman isn't the first governor to venture into India. In recent weeks, both California's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ger and Minnesota's Gov. Tim Pawlenty have lead trade missions to India, Huntsman said.
The higher education institutions and businesses are responsible for their own costs on the trade mission. Huntsman said he is personally picking up his own tab, as he has done on past trade missions. Participants are scheduled to return to Utah on Nov. 4.
